Pool Cars — Key Cabinet (Contractor Onboarding, Sec. 4)

Key cabinet is in the ground-floor utility room, Building B, Torwick Park site. Contractors may take pool-car keys for approved errands only. Log every key out and back in on the clipboard. Fuel card stays with the key fob. Return cars to bays 11–14, keys back in the cabinet same day. Lost keys: report to site office immediately, replacement charged to your firm. Do not duplicate keys.

Cabinet opens with the code below.

door code, tagef-bajop: bdg-SB-7

Title: Expired creds blocking font vendoring job

The nightly job that vendors third-party fonts into the Quillbox build stopped Tuesday. Root cause: credentials for the internal FontCache mirror expired and nobody got the rotation alert. Impact: builds fall back to stale fonts; the new Herslow Sans weights aren't shipping. Fix: rotate the mirror credential, update the vendoring job config, add expiry alerting. For the sync: rotation is done and the new key for the mirror is below.

gateway credential: vxb4-QTMv

## Approvals — Tidelet Widget

Heads up: any change to Tidelet's prediction tables needs an approval before deploy, even at 3am. The harbor feeds for Port Wrenlow are touchy, and a bad push means wrong tide times on public kiosks. Emergency rollbacks are fine without review, but flag them in the channel. The approver of record is listed below.

approver of bagug-bagag = Holael Pramir

FAQ: What if I'm locked out of the Hueledger audit workspace?

Contractors running the color-contrast audit for the Marrowgate redesign sometimes lose access after the weekly permission sweep. Don't create a new account; that breaks audit attribution. Instead, open the Hueledger recovery prompt, confirm your assigned component list, and enter the team passphrase printed directly beneath this answer.

unlock words, bagug-kadup: wenath-zorael